: For users buying used hardware, obtaining a license key is notoriously difficult. Official channels often require an active support contract, and third-party resellers may list them at prohibitively high "enterprise" prices ($200+), which many feel defeats the purpose of buying "cheap" used gear.

Standard iRMC S4 features are robust, allowing for agentless monitoring of HDDs, RAID configurations, and system sensors even if the OS fails. However, a license key is required to access premium capabilities:
